25 | Licensing Program Analyst (LPA) Angelica Boyles conducted an unannounced Required Annual Inspection. LPA was greeted by House Manager Carla Lara, identified herself, and discussed the purpose of the visit. Administrator Rene Doehrer later joined the visit.
The facility is licensed for a capacity of four (4) clients, of which all must be ambulatory.
LPA, accompanied by House Manager, toured the interior and exterior of the facility, and inspected each room. The facility was clean, sanitary, and in good repair. Pathways were free of obstruction and slip hazards. Client bedrooms contained the required furnishings, and padded mattress covers. Doors, windows, screens, toilets, and showers were in working order. Extra linens and hygiene supplies were present. The facility had sufficient space and equipment to facilitate dining, laundry, visitation, meetings, and client activities. Hot water temperature at taps accessible to clients measured within regulation and the facility’s ambient temperature was comfortable and complaint.
There was at least 2 days of perishable food, and at least 7 days of non-perishable food present, all safely stored. Cooking/dining equipment and utensils were present. There were no sharp objects, toxic chemicals/poisons, or open-faced heaters accessible to clients. Medications were labeled, as required, and stored in locked areas.
